A gentle walk through lush fern gullies leads to this delicate waterfall cascading over a mossy rock shelf in the Grampians. The falls are at their most impressive after winter rains when the flow increases dramatically. The surrounding temperate rainforest pocket creates a cool microclimate even on warm days. A peaceful alternative to the busier Mackenzie Falls.
Know before you go
Trail can be slippery after rain. The path is well maintained but includes some steps. Best flow after sustained rainfall in winter and spring.
